Legal Framework Surrounding Crypto in Vietnam

  • Regulations: Vietnam’s government has taken a cautious approach towards cryptocurrency. The State Bank of Vietnam (SBV) only recognizes cryptocurrencies as assets, not as legal tender.
  • Compliance Requirements: It is crucial for real estate developers and investors to understand the compliance framework when dealing with cryptocurrencies. This includes KYC (Know Your Customer) protocols.
  • Licensing Obligations: All cryptocurrency exchanges must acquire a license from the government, and real estate transactions utilizing cryptocurrencies need to comply with local laws.

Understanding Real Estate Transactions via Cryptocurrency

Integrating cryptocurrencies into real estate transactions may not be as straightforward as it appears. Here are several factors to consider:

  • Title Transfer: The method of transferring property titles when cryptocurrency is used can differ significantly from traditional currency methods.
  • Currency Fluctuation Risks: Fluctuations in cryptocurrency value can impact the sale price of properties.
  • Tax Implications: Investors must consider crypto taxation standards in Vietnam as they may differ from traditional real estate tax protocols.

Best Practices for Compliance

For investors and developers involved in Vietnam’s crypto real estate market, adhering to compliance standards is essential. Here are best practices to enhance compliance:

  • Engage Legal Experts: Work with legal professionals experienced in cryptocurrency and real estate.
  • Stay Informed: Regularly update yourself on regulatory changes from the SBV and government policies.
  • Transparent Transactions: Ensure all transactions are documented and transparent to facilitate smoother audits.
